Town of Palm Beach Goes Underground
The results of Tuesday’s vote on the undergrounding bond referendum are in, with the majority voting in favor of bonds. With the numbers almost tied, 50.72% (2,174 residents) for and 49.28% (2,113 residents) against the bonds, Town Clerk Susan Owens does not expect a recount of the votes. “The split
